Welcome to on-call for the Glimmerpane design system! Our snapshot tests live in the `snapcheck` suite and run on every merge to main. If a UI component changes visually, the diff bot flags it — usually it's an intentional tweak, so just approve the new baseline. If it's 2am and snapshots are failing across the board, it's almost always a font-loading race, not your problem. To unlock the baseline store and re-approve snapshots in bulk, use the recovery passphrase below.

recovery phrase for tahag-taguf: wenix-caswyn

# Telemetry payload compression settings for the Larkspur agent.
# On-call note: these constants control batch size and compression level
# before payloads leave the edge collector. Raising the level saves
# bandwidth but increases CPU on constrained devices; lowering the batch
# threshold reduces latency but hurts compression ratio. If collectors in
# the Westhollow fleet fall behind, adjust cautiously and watch queue
# depth. The current production constants follow.

limits module of fajog-tawig:
RATE_LIMITS = {
    "druwyn": 2,
    "quenael": 10,
    "wenix": 2,
    "druael": 2,
}

Deep-link routing, Brindlefox app. All links hit the router service first; it maps path patterns to screens via the manifest in config/links. Unknown paths fall back to home — never 404 in-app. On-call: if links loop, check the manifest cache version against the release tag and flush if mismatched. Logs live under router.deeplink. Emergency access to the routing console requires the recovery passphrase below.

recovery phrase for fahif-hadup: sorix-holael